Common Misconceptions
One common misconception is that inverse proportion problems are only applicable to complex, abstract concepts. In reality, these problems are present in everyday life, from simple physics problems to financial calculations.
Inverse proportion is a fundamental concept in mathematics, describing the relationship between two variables that change in opposite directions. In simple terms, as one variable increases, the other decreases proportionally. To solve inverse proportion problems, one must first identify the variables and their relationships, then apply algebraic techniques to isolate and solve for the unknown. This involves using formulas, graphing, and logical reasoning to unravel the problem.
